§ 15-23-8 — Funds deposited into special account; expenditure and investment; audits

(a)The board shall have control of the funds provided for in this chapter. All funds received shall be deposited in a special account to be known as the __________________ County Fund for the Administration of Alternative Dispute Resolution Programs. The board shall have authority to expend the funds in accordance with this chapter and to invest any of the funds so received in any investments which are legal investments for fiduciaries in this state.
(b)Boards shall comply with and be subject to the audit requirements of Code Section 36-81-7 .
